What's the story

WhatsApp has released a new update for its Android app, version 2.25.37.1, through the Google Play Beta Program. The update comes with an interesting new feature that allows users to save drafts of their status updates. The capability is being rolled out to select beta testers and is expected to reach more users in the coming weeks.

User benefits

New feature enhances user experience

The new status draft-saving feature is designed to improve the user experience by giving users more control over their content. It comes in handy when a user starts creating a status with text, drawings, or stickers but wants to continue later instead of publishing it immediately. The new saving tool saves all changes without forcing users to start from scratch.

Draft accessibility

Save button ensures easy access to drafts

The editor now features a save button at the top of the screen, among other familiar tools. This makes it easy for users to save their status draft in seconds and continue editing whenever they want. Along with this main button, some users may also see another type of save option when trying to leave the editor by hitting the back button.

Editing reliability

System preserves all elements for reliable editing

The system saves everything, including the overlays, text formatting, and positioning, so the draft opens exactly as it was left. This behavior creates a reliable editing environment, especially for those who invest time in detailed adjustments before deciding whether that update is ready to share.
